3. Understanding foreclosure property

When assessing a foreclosure property the first thing that you will want to do is find out how many repairs you will have to make before you can sell it, or set it up as a rental property. Remember, every dollar that you have to put into the home will cut back on the amount of profit that you make. If you are not skilled enough to make an accurate assessment in this area, you will want to get a contractor to take a look at the property. They will be able to give you an estimate on how much the repairs are going to cost you. Even if you plan on renovating the house on your own, it's important to remember that materials can cost you more than you might think. Try to come up with an estimate that is as precise as you can.

4. Understanding profit

Comprehend the profit you could glean from the home after finding out information on the home. This may seem difficult, but you should be able to make an educated guess without many problems at all. The first thing that you will need to do is factor in all of the repair costs. After that, if you plan on renting the home, you will want to get an idea of how much you can get per month. This will give you an idea of how much money you can expect to make every year. You can then take this number to calculate the amount of time that you will need to make back your initial investment and start profiting. If you are going to be reselling the house, get an idea of what the market value is on the home. This can be done by checking out similar homes in the area. You will have gained the ability to calculate your profit after completing the above.
